Pengaruh Pemberian Pupuk Kascing dan Hormon Giberellin (Ga3) Terhadap Produksi Benih Mentimun (Cucumis sativus L.)

The need for cucumbers is high but not supported by existing production, so efforts are needed to increase cucumber seed production to meet these needs. This study aims to determine the effect of vermicompost fertilizer and gibberellin hormone in seed production and quality. The research was conducted in Auguts – December 2022 Antirogo, Sumbersari District, Jember Regency. The design used was a factorial Randomized Complete Blok Design (RCBD) with 2 factors and 3 replications. The first factor was vermicompost fertilizer which consisted of 3 levels, namely K1 (240 g/plant), K2 (360 g/plant), and K3 (480 g/plant). The second factor was gibberellin which consisted of 3 levels, namely G1 (100 mg/l), G2 (150 mg/l), and G3(200 mg/l). The data were analyzed using the ANOVA test and continued with the DMRT (Duncan Multiple Range Test) with a level 5%. The result showed that the vermicompost fertilizer treatment hada a significant effect on the K3 level (480 g/plant) on the fruit weight parameter with a value of 556.13 grams and the fruit length parameter of 25.48 cm. The gibberellin treatment showed a very significant effect on the G1 level (100 mg/l) on the flowering age parameter with a value of 23.89. The interaction between the two K2G1 treatments (360 g/plant and 100 mg/l) showed a very significant effect on the parameters of the number of seeds with good planting of 318.02 grains, the weight of seeds with good planting of 5.27 grams,of seed production per hectare of 878.42 kg.
